Ivey Park is located to the west stop of downtown and provides stunning sights in the Forks in the Thames, a playground, spray pad, and connections for the Thames Valley Parkway. The dwellings are Virtually completely apartments or condos possibly in new tall towers or from the upper floors of three or 4 Tale properties with retail on the street… Read More